Passion and Entrepreneurship: A Perfect Match

Entrepreneurship is an exciting and fulfilling journey. It allows you to take control of your career and become your own boss. However, starting a new business can be challenging, and the odds of succeeding are low. According to the Small Business Administration, only about 50% of new businesses survive beyond the first five years.

So, what does it take to succeed as an entrepreneur? One of the most important factors is passion.

The Power of Passion

Passion is the driving force behind many successful businesses. When you are passionate about something, you are willing to put in the long hours and hard work that it takes to turn your dream into a reality. You are also more likely to inspire others and build a strong team that shares your vision.

Passion can also help you overcome the inevitable obstacles and failures that come with entrepreneurship. When you encounter challenges, your passion will keep you motivated to keep pushing forward and find a way to succeed.

Combining Passion and Business

Combining your passion with your business idea can give you a competitive advantage. By pursuing something you are passionate about, you will be more enthusiastic about your work, and you will have a deeper understanding of your customers' needs and wants.

For example, if you are passionate about fitness, you may want to start a gym or personal training business. By doing so, you will be able to share your knowledge and passion with others and build a community around your brand.

However, it is important to remember that passion alone is not enough. You still need to have a solid business plan and strategy in place to ensure your success. Here are a few tips:

  • Research your market and competition. Understand the needs and wants of your target customers, and find ways to differentiate yourself from your competitors.
  • Create a solid financial plan. Understand the costs involved in starting and running your business, and make sure you have a plan for funding and managing your cash flow.
  • Build a strong team. Find people who share your passion and can help you execute your vision. Make sure you have a clear communication plan and a system for delegating tasks.
